I checked hooded dryer with heat. I would air dry more often but my hair literally takes all day and I never had the time. What I normally do is brush my hair back into a ponytail and put my hair into one big shirley temple curl(that's what I call it). Then I put a scarf on so the heat isn't directly on my hair. I do this until my hair is pretty much all the way dry then let the rest air dry, next I blow dry just a little and flat iron.
I checked hooded dryer with heat (roller set). Have been doing this since I was a child. Keeps my hair healthier than blowdrying. Also, most ethnic / spanish beauty shops in NYC use rollers & hooded dryers. Airdrying at home would take too long.

I air dry with braids. It's easist for me. I am never in a hurry when I do it, because I normally wash my hair first thing saturday morning, and it dries while I do my "chores" or while I'm acting like I'm doing something.
I checked air-dry with braids, but I actually don't do that exactly. If I want to stretch my hair out in preparation for a style, I'll do jumbo twists on my wet hair and then band it overnight. If I want to do small twists, I'll put my hair in two ponypuffs and leave them to dry part-way. At that point I'll begin twisting.
